There’s something different about golf in British Columbia. Maybe it’s the feeling of teeing off beside glacier-fed lakes as the morning mist lifts from the mountains. Maybe it’s the quiet of a forest-lined fairway, the sound of waves crashing beyond an oceanfront green, or the way every drive between courses feels like part of the adventure itself.

Across BC, golf is woven into landscapes that invite you to slow down, explore, and experience the province in a completely different way. From the rugged coastlines of Vancouver Island to the sun-drenched valleys of the Okanagan and the towering peaks of the Kootenays, every round tells a different story — shaped by nature, small communities, and the journeys between them.
